How do you determine what clinical equipment your facility truly requires? Begin by evaluating the solutions you supply. Determine which treatments require specific tools. Talk with your personnel; they have beneficial understandings on daily procedures and equipment efficiency. Gather data on person volume and kinds of situations handled to recognize trends and need. Next off, assess the problem of your present tools. Are there regular break downs or obsolete innovation? It's vital to balance quality with need, so focus on items that boost patient care and safety and security. Produce a shopping list based upon these assessments and classify things by seriousness. Don't neglect to take into account room and workflow; tools ought to fit effortlessly into your center's layout. Remain informed about improvements in clinical modern technology that can profit your technique. By thoroughly assessing your facility's requirements, you'll ensure you spend in the appropriate equipment to support both staff and clients successfully.

Regulatory Bodies Overview

Steering the landscape of clinical equipment needs a strong understanding of the numerous regulative bodies that guarantee compliance with necessary standards. In the United States, the Food and Medication Management (FDA) plays a necessary function in supervising clinical tools, making certain they're efficient and risk-free. You'll likewise experience companies like the International Organization for Standardization (ISO), which sets global standards for top quality and safety. Furthermore, the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Provider (CMS) applies regulations affecting repayment and facility standards. Acquainting yourself with these entities helps you browse conformity, prevent costly charges, and ensure the very best end results for people.
